#2CBA2C Color
#2CBA2C is rgb(44, 186, 44) in RGB, hsl(120, 62%, 45%) in HSL, and about cmyk(76%, 0%, 76%, 27%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Pastel Green (#03C03C),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.05.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#2CBA2C Channel Values
How #2CBA2C bre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 44 · G 186 · B 44 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 120° · S 62% · L 45%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 120° · S 76% · V 73%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 76% · M 0% · Y 76% · K 27%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.57:1 vs white · 8.17: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#2CBA2C background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#2CBA2C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#2CBA2C?
#2CBA2C is a mid-tone green — rgb(44, 186, 44) in RGB and hsl(120, 62%, 45%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Pastel Green (#03C03C),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.05.
What is the RGB value of #2CBA2C?
#2CBA2C is rgb(44, 186, 44) — red 44, green 186, and blue 44 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#2CBA2C?
#2CBA2C converts to approximately cmyk(76%, 0%, 76%, 27%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#2CBA2C be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#2CBA2C scores 2.57:1 against white and 8.17: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#2CBA2C as a CSS color keyword?
No. #2CBA2C is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is limegreen (#32CD32) at a CIE76 distance of 8.56,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
